Getting Started with WordPress.com

Creating a website on WordPress.com is simple and straightforward. Follow these steps to set up your site:

  1. Sign Up for an Account
  2. Visit the WordPress.com website.
  3. Click on the “Start your website” button.
  4. Fill in your email address, choose a username, and create a password.
  5. Confirm your email address to activate your account.

  6. Choose a Domain Name

  7. After signing up, you will be prompted to choose a domain name.
  8. You can select a free WordPress subdomain (e.g., yoursite.wordpress.com) or purchase a custom domain.

  1. Select a Plan
  2. WordPress.com offers several plans ranging from free to premium options.
  3. Consider your needs: If you want basic features, the free plan is sufficient. For advanced capabilities, explore the paid plans.

  4. Pick a Theme

  5. Browse through the available themes and select one that suits your style and purpose.
  6. You can customize your theme later to fit your branding.

  7. Customize Your Site

  8. Use the WordPress Customizer to adjust your site’s appearance.
  9. Add a logo, change colors, and modify fonts to create a unique look.

  10. Create Essential Pages

  11. Start with key pages such as Home, About, Contact, and Blog.
  12. Use the WordPress editor to add content, images, and media to each page.

  13. Publish Your Content

  14. Once you have your pages set up, start writing blog posts or product descriptions.
  15. Hit the “Publish” button when you’re ready to share your content with the world.

Benefits of Using WordPress.com

WordPress.com comes with numerous advantages that make it an appealing choice for many users:

  • Ease of Use: The platform is designed for everyone, regardless of technical skill. You can create and manage your site without needing to write any code.
  • Hosting Included: WordPress.com takes care of hosting, so you don’t have to worry about server management or security.
  • Built-in Features: Enjoy essential features like SEO tools, analytics, and social media integration right out of the box.
  • Community Support: Access a vast community of users and developers for support and inspiration.
  • Mobile-Friendly: Your site will automatically be responsive, ensuring it looks great on all devices.

Challenges to Consider

While WordPress.com offers many benefits, there are some challenges you should be aware of:

  • Limited Customization: Free and lower-tier plans have restrictions on themes and plugins. You may need a higher plan for more advanced features.
  • Ads on Free Plans: Free sites may display WordPress.com ads. Upgrading to a paid plan can remove these ads.
  • E-commerce Limitations: While you can set up an online store, some features may be limited unless you opt for a higher-tier plan.

Cost Considerations

WordPress.com offers various pricing tiers:

  1. Free Plan: Basic features with limited customization options. Suitable for personal blogs or simple sites.
  2. Personal Plan: Removes ads and allows custom domain names. Ideal for small business sites.
  3. Premium Plan: Offers advanced customization, monetization options, and additional storage.
  4. Business and eCommerce Plans: Provide extensive features for larger businesses, including plugins and advanced SEO tools.

Evaluate your needs and budget before selecting a plan to ensure you get the most value.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What is WordPress.com?
WordPress.com is a hosted platform that allows users to create and manage websites without needing to install software or manage servers. It offers various plans, including a free option.

Can I use my domain name with WordPress.com?
Yes, you can use a custom domain name with WordPress.com, but you may need to upgrade to a paid plan to do so.

Are there any costs associated with using WordPress.com?
While there is a free plan available, premium features and custom domains require a subscription to one of the paid plans.

Can I add plugins to my WordPress.com site?
The ability to add plugins is limited to higher-tier plans, specifically the Business and eCommerce plans.

Is WordPress.com suitable for e-commerce?
Yes, WordPress.com allows you to set up an online store, but for advanced e-commerce features, consider upgrading to the Business or eCommerce plan.
